New Valleyfair Roller Coaster in 2007!

Roller-coaster enthusiasts have reason to scream.

Valleyfair officials announced Thursday that the Shakopee amusement park is adding a wooden roller coaster replete with a steep twisting opening drop, making it one of the first parks in the county to have a coaster with that innovation. Construction on the $6.5 million Renegade, designed by Great Coasters International Inc. of Sunbury, Pa., will begin as soon as the city of Shakopee approves permits for the ride.
